The bur's tapered nature will generate an optimally tapered entrance. However, when processing the workpiece, the bur must be held parallel to the long axis of the tooth. If the angle of the bur is not taken into consideration, the preparation will be over-tapered, and an excessive amount of tooth will be taken away. The bur is moved down the pulp floor by the drive mechanism, however, it will stop cutting if it encounters a wall. The length of the cutting surface is 9 millimeters, while the overall length is 21 millimeters. Because it does not cut, the blunt tip prevents the instrument from penetrating the pulp chamber floor or the walls of the root canal. When working on the internal axial walls, the lateral cutting edges of the Endo Z bur are utilized to flare, flatten, and refine the surface.Īfter the initial penetration, this long, tapered bur will provide an aperture in the shape of a funnel, which will allow access to the pulp chamber. Popular because the end that does not cut can be positioned directly on the pulpal floor without the risk of puncturing the tooth. It is a carbide bur that has a safe end that is tapered and has been rounded off. This is made possible by the bur's unique design, which combines a round and a cone. The Endo Z Bur is a combination of a round and cone-shaped coarse diamond-coated bur that offers access to the pulp chamber and chamber wall preparation in a single operation.
